Significance: A 19th century Queen Anne house, with a Gothic flavor. This house was built for Judge Charles Fernald, a leading legal and political figure in late 19th century Southern California society.
Survey number: HABS CA-240
Building/structure dates: 1862 Initial Construction
Building/structure dates: ca. 1880 Subsequent Work
Building/structure dates: after 1920 Subsequent Work
Building/structure dates: 1959 Subsequent Work
